Tesla's 'Bioweapon Defense Mode' helped someone escaping a fire

A Tesla owner recently posted a video using the vehicle’s “Bioweapon Defense Mode” while driving near a wildfire in California.

According to Tesla, this mode activates a “HEPA filtration system capable of stripping the outside air of pollen, bacteria, and pollution before they enter the cabin and systematically scrubbing the air inside the cabin to eliminate any trace of these particles.”

This is similar to the kind of air filtration system you would find in a hospital. Tesla says it’s “hundreds of times more efficient” than the average car’s filtration system. Tesla claims you could survive a “military-grade bio attack” with their air filter. It’s available in the Model S and the Model X.

A reddit user claim they recently tried the filtration while escaping a fire in California and found it to be effective.

Elon Musk recommended people escaping fires in California use the filtration system last year. Many people did use it during those fires and found it helpful. This reddit story is further evidence that it works.

“Bioweapon defense mode significantly helped with air quality in the car,” the reddit user wrote. “Also the car didn’t require us to turn off autopilot and followed lane marking well until we decided ourselves to turn it off!”

Last year, large parts of Northern California were experiencing extremely poor air quality because of fires in the region, so it might be smart to use this filter even if you’re not that close to the fire.
